Mancos is located in Colorado. Mancos, Colorado 81328has a population of 1,168. Mancos 81328 is less family-centric than the surrounding county with 23.1%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 28.74%.
The median household income in Mancos, Colorado 81328 is $57,024. The median household income for the surrounding county is $58,335 compared to the national median of $69,021. The median age of people living in Mancos 81328 is 40.3 years.
The average high temperature in July is 84.7 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 15.4 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 18 inches per year, with 66.9 inches of snow per year.
